Reginald William Crowly (1885- ), engineer and journalist, of London
Press secretary of the Brooklands Automobile Racing Club
1911 Living at Woodlands, Baring Crescent, Beaconsfield, Bucks: Reginald William Crowly (age 25 born Hendon), Engineering Journalist and Exhibition Organizer. With his wife Helga Marie Crowly.[1]
Emigrated to the USA
